Mindfulness meditation combats chronic pain.
Mindfulness triggers a neurological, pain-relieving response. It also helps you cultivate a nonjudgmental, accepting attitude toward the pain.
Pain is a combination of mental, emotional and physical and mindfulness is a fantastic way to change the mental aspect of it.
You change your relationship to the pain so that it stops ruling your life.
Meditation promotes relaxation, calming of the nervous system, muscle relaxation and a reduction in stress which all help to relieve chronic pain.
What you can not do is focus on reducing your pain. Instead focus on reducing stress, the joy in your life and mindfulness- the pain will gradually decrease over time.
Practice mindful meditation 10-20 minutes per day.
You have the power to turn down the volume control on the brain’s pain-sensing network allowing you to consciously feel less pain.
